Journeyman Carpenter

S&L Specialty Contracting Inc.
10.2006 - 08.2009
  • I worked on the city funded quieter home program for the LAX airport, cities of El Segundo and Inglewood
  • Responsible for managing daily activity of the carpenter crew, remove old non-sufficient doors and windows, birdhouse and baffles from any point of noise entry
  • I Also worked with the HVAC crew helping performing demo and building unit platforms; Building to code and re installing new decibel rated doors and windows to eliminate noise pollution from the airbuses from LAX airport
  • I worked all aspects of the home phases from demolition to reframe, finish woodwork to final walkthrough
  • I ran a crew of 4-6 during this time
  • I worked closely with inspectors and coordinated the completion of the punch list
  • I was in charge of reviewing the daily scope of work and pulled materials required to complete work
  • After each home completion I completed warranty work.
